As an Educational Director, for The Senior Service Resources Group, (A Non for Profit Dedicated to helping seniors, in their time of need) I visit "Senior Communities" on a regular basis. I have found The Villas at Riverwood, To be extremely Clean and free of odors. The staff, was not only pleasant to deal with, but acted as if they were genuinely glad to be there. (reasonably rare for this kind of environment. I found the residents to be clean, and well cared for. The "Common Areas" were free of clutter. The furniture was comfortable, yet functional, (solid arms, sturdy bases, reasonably firm seats.) Some of the seating, having no arms, suitable for sliding. Residents, appeared to be happy. There were many activities for individuals and groups alike. I would not hesitate to recommend this community to any member of my family.

My Mom has been living at Atria a little over six months now. Mom has kidney and heart disease. When she first arrived at Atria her kidneys were showing high phosphorus and potassium levels. Since dining at the Atria her levels are now normal for her age! Thank you Dave and the dining staff for the fantastic healthy food served. Even Mom's doctor stated "what are they feeding her, very good!" I recommend Atria to all who need assisted living, It's a fabulous place with terrific people working and living there. Also, clean, homey, and beautiful grounds. Thank you, Tina and staff for all of your loving care.
